It is National Assistant Principal Week! We hope you will join us in recognizing our Amazing Assistant Principal, Mrs. Ashley Crouse. Mrs. Crouse is truly an essential part of our TEAM. We love and appreciate her flexibility, work ethic, and dedication to seeing our entire school community thrive! We are so fortunate to have her at Carver.
Mrs. Crouse grew up on the coast of North Carolina and attended East Carolina University where she earned an undergraduate degree in elementary education. After graduation, she returned home and spent her first two years as an educator teaching 5th grade in her hometown. Since relocating to the Raleigh area, Mrs. Crouse has had the opportunity to serve the students in Wake County for the last 14 years. Throughout her time in WCPSS, she has taught first, second, and third grades, and served as an intervention teacher and instructional facilitator. She  returned to East Carolina University in 2021 and earned her Masters of School Administration. She was thrilled to be named the assistant principal at Carver in September 2022. Mrs. Crouse values the relationships she has built with students, staff, families, and the community over the years. She feels fortunate to work in a place that fuels her passion and makes every day worthwhile.

Social Emotional Learning at Carver:
Second Step- Unit 4 Lesson 18
This week, students reviewed key skills they’ve learned throughout the year to help them grow socially and emotionally. These include managing strong emotions, showing empathy, solving problems, and making responsible decisions. Reflecting on their progress helps students recognize how these skills support their success at school and in life.
